Located in the heart of New Zealand's beautiful North Island, North Shore is a coastal district boasting stunning sandy beaches, natural parks, and a bustling cityscape. Due to its incredible variety of landscapes and places of interest, one of the best ways to explore this locality is by hiring a car. With a private vehicle, you can travel at your own pace, stop where you want and see places that are not easily accessible by public transport.

Devonport, a short drive away from the city centre, is a historic maritime village overflowing with quaint shops, cafes and some of the city's best beaches. Another must-visit destination is the Albany Scenic Reserve, located just a 20-minute drive from central North Shore. Here you can indulge in gorgeous nature trails and breathtaking views. Furthermore, the sprawling Flora Track in Lake Pupuke is only a 10-minute car ride away, allowing you to take a scenic walk around the lake in less than an hour.

North Shore truly is a car traveller's paradise, with distances easily manageable, allowing ample time to take in all the sights and sounds. From stunning urban landscapes to relaxing beach spots and untamed natural spectacles, North Shore has something for everyone. Top Road Connections

Useful Information for North Shore Tourists

  1. North Shore - Auckland: A drive of 13 kilometres, which takes 20 minutes via State Highway 1 (SH1). The roads are well-maintained.
  2. North Shore - Hamilton: The journey is 127 kilometres and takes around 1 hour 30 minutes via SH1 which is typically busy but scenic.
  3. North Shore - Hobbiton: At 172 kilometres, it takes about 2 hours 10 minutes via SH1 and SH27, through a mix of urban and rural landscapes.
  4. North Shore - Rotorua: A 228 kilometre journey, taking around 2 hours 30 minutes via SH1 and motorways, featuring beautiful countryside views.
  5. North Shore - Wellington: This is a long drive of 663 kilometres, which takes about 8 hours via SH1; the roads are generally in good condition.
  6. North Shore - Bay of Islands: A 225 kilometre journey, approximately 3 hours driving through SH1, offering beautiful seaside views.
  7. North Shore - Waitomo Caves: The journey is 194 kilometres and takes approximately 2 hours 30 minutes via SH1 and SH3, with lush green landscapes along the way.

North Shore Driving

Common Questions Answered

1. What is the speed limit in North Shore?

The speed limit in North Shore and the rest of the country varies depending on the type of road. Residential areas usually have a limit of 50km/h, main roads go up to 60-80km/h, and motorways can go up to 100km/h. School zones have a reduced speed limit during school hours, usually 40km/h.

2. What kind of driving license is required to drive in North Shore?

If you hold a valid driving license in English, you can drive in North Shore and throughout the country for up to one year. If your driving licence is not in English, you will need to bring an international driving permit.

3. Are there speed cameras in North Shore?

Yes, there are speed cameras installed in various parts of the North Shore. They are in operation 24 hours a day and are aimed to ensure the adherence to speed limits for everyone's safety.

4. Are there any toll routes in North Shore?

Yes, certain motorways in North Shore and its surroundings are toll roads. These include the North Shore Toll Road and the Auckland Northern Gateway. Motorists are usually required to pay electronically.

5. What are the crucial driving rules one must remember in North Shore?

Driving is on the left-hand side of the road. The driver and all passengers must wear seat belts. You must give way to all traffic crossing or approaching from your right. Overtaking other cars is generally only allowed when you have a clear view of oncoming traffic and the road ahead.

6. How bad can traffic get in North Shore?

Like any city, North Shore can have heavy traffic during rush hours, which are usually from 7am to 9am and 4pm to 6pm on weekdays. Plan your journey accordingly to avoid delays.

7. How safe is driving in North Shore?

North Shore is generally considered safe for driving. However, accidents can happen, so always adhere to the speed limits, traffic rules, and remain vigilant for changing road conditions.

8. Is there any specific documentation required for driving in North Shore?

Besides holding a valid driving licence, you are required to carry car insurance documentation and the vehicle registration papers while driving in North Shore.

9. What should I do in the event of a car breakdown?

In case of a car breakdown, ensure to park safely off the road or in an emergency lane if possible. for further assistance call your car hire company immediately.

10. Is it common to find parking spaces in North Shore?

Parking in North Shore varies by location: the city centre can be quite busy, but there are usually car parks available for a fee. Shopping centres and attractions usually have their own parking.

11. What should be known about night driving in North Shore?

North Shore is well-lit at night but be aware that some country roads might have less visibility. Always be on the lookout for pedestrians and cyclists, and slower moving traffic.

12. Are there pedestrian zones in North Shore?

Yes, there are areas designated as pedestrian zones in North Shore. Vehicles are not allowed in these zones or have limited access.

13. Can I turn at a red traffic light in North Shore?

No, turns on red are not allowed in North Shore. You must wait for the light to turn green unless there's a sign that states otherwise.

14. Where can I find information about road legislation in North Shore?

The New Zealand Transport Agency's website provides comprehensive information about road legislation in North Shore and the rest of the country.

15. Do I need to carry any safety equipment in the car while driving in North Shore?

It's not mandatory to carry safety equipment, but we recommend having at least a first aid kit and a high visibility vest in the car for any emergencies.

North Shore Attractions

Must-See Places Around North Shore

  1. Auckland's City Centre: Visit the vibrant heart of Auckland, filled with first-class dining and shopping experiences.
  2. Sky Tower: Climb up New Zealand's tallest building for an unforgettable panoramic view of the city.
  3. Waiheke Island: Known for its vineyards and pristine beaches, perfect for day trips.
  4. Waitakere Ranges: A rainforest paradise, home to beautiful waterfalls and black-sand beaches.
  5. Devonport: A seaside village full of cafes, boutique shops and picturesque views.
  6. Auckland Harbour Bridge: Enjoy a spectacular view of the city and nearby islands from this iconic landmark.
  7. Mission Bay Beach: Auckland's most famous urban beach offering excellent walking and cycling paths.
  8. Eden Park Stadium: Catch a rugby or cricket match in New Zealand's largest sports stadium.

North Shore Roadtrips

Scenic Drives from North Shore

  1. Auckland to Bay of Islands: A beautiful 244km drive north with picturesque views of pristine beaches, bushland, and historical sites.
  2. Auckland to Rotorua: Enjoy a 3-hour, 228km drive through the heart of New Zealand's North Island. Key sights include Waitomo Caves and the thermal springs of Rotorua.
  3. North Shore to Coromandel Peninsula: Embark on a 166km drive across diverse landscapes featuring extensive coastlines, native bush and unique rock formations.
  4. North Shore to Waitomo Caves: A thrilling 200km roadtrip known for its spectacular limestone caves and glowworms. Ideal for adventure lovers!
  5. Auckland to Cape Reinga: A longer 421km journey offering a unique backdrop of quaint towns, stunning flora and fauna, and the historic lighthouse at the northernmost tip of the country.
  6. Auckland to Tongariro National Park: A 4-hour, 335km drive through rolling green farmland and forests leading to the dramatic landscapes of the park and its world-famous hiking tracks.
  7. Auckland to Napier: A 422km journey leading to the sunny Hawke's Bay region, renowned for its Art Deco architecture, vineyards and local gourmet food produce.
  8. Auckland to Taupo: A 278km scenic route encompassing some of New Zealand's top tourist destinations including Huka Falls and the magnificent Lake Taupo.
